The Lebanese government renewed an airport advertising contract with Group Plus for LL3.1 billion, Transportation and Public Works Minister Ghazi Aridi said in a news conference Monday. “This is a good [source of revenue] to the public Treasury given the [current] economic conditions,” he said. Aridi said the airport has achieved its full capacity of 6 million passengers and urged officials to consider expansion plans to help boost economic activity. He said the government was still mulling the re-establishment of the Rene Mouawad Air Base in Qleyate as a second civilian airport. From TheDailyStar
